✔ Is Electrolysis Permanent?
Electrolysis is one of the most reliable methods of permanent hair removal, used by professionals for decades with excellent results.
During the treatment, the hair follicle is carefully cauterized, destroying not only the existing hair but also the cells responsible for future hair growth.

When is Electrolysis Recommended?
Electrolysis is ideal when:
- Permanent hair removal is required
- Treating white, blonde, or fine hairs
- Removing individual hairs without affecting surrounding areas
- Treating delicate areas such as the face
How Does It Work?
The procedure requires precision and expertise.
A very fine probe is inserted into the hair follicle, delivering a small amount of electrical current.
This process destroys the hair root and the responsible cells, leading to permanent elimination of the hair.
How Often Are Sessions Needed?
Due to the hair growth cycle, sessions are typically recommended once per month.
Hair Growth Cycle
Hair grows in three phases:
- Anagen (growth phase): Best stage for effective treatment
- Catagen (transition phase)
- Telogen (resting phase): No effective result, as the hair is already inactive
Optimal results are achieved during the anagen phase, when the hair is actively growing.
Electrolysis vs Other Hair Removal Methods
Advantages:
✔Effective for all hair types, including white and fine hair
✔Immediate confirmation of follicle destruction
✔ Targets individual hairs without affecting surrounding skin
✔ Ideal for areas with moles or skin lesions
Disadvantages:
- More time-consuming compared to laser
- May cause mild irritation lasting about one hour
Suitable Age
There is no strict age limitation.
However, it is generally recommended after childhood, commonly starting during adolescence (15–17 years old).
Can It Be Done Year-Round?
Yes, electrolysis can be performed throughout the entire year, regardless of sun exposure.
Pregnancy
Electrolysis is considered a safe method, with no known effects on pregnancy.
The electrical current used is minimal and applied locally at a very shallow skin level.
